Mary Brunkow, Fred Ramsdell and Shimon Sakaguchi have been awarded the 2025 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ine for their groundbreaking discoveries concerning peripheral immune tolerance that prevents the immune system from harming the body.
The Nobel Prize laureates identified the immune system’s security guards, regulatory T cells, thus laying the foundation for a new field of research. The discoveries have also led to the development of potential medical treatments that are now being evaluated in clinical trials.
The hope is to be able to treat or cure autoimmune diseases, provide more effective cancer treatments and prevent serious complications after stem cell transplants.

Major organ involvement, such as ocular, vascular, and neurological issues, is often influenced by the age of onset in #Behçet’s disease (BD), with these conditions frequently observed before the age of 25.
Recent comparative studies indicate that peripheral and axial arthritis, folliculitis, and nonspecific gastrointestinal symptoms such as abdominal pain and diarrhea are more frequent in juvenile BD. In contrast, neurological and vascular events are more common in adults. Consequently, this suggests a relatively better prognosis for the juvenile group. In parallel, juvenile BD has been found to have lower disease activity and severity scores. Reviewing various epidemiological studies, the inconsistencies in results likely stem from differences in the scope of representative data, age range, disease duration, and methodological approaches. Moreover, outcome data from studies encompassing a diverse range of ethnic backgrounds and age groups would be particularly valuable.
📸 Main differences in clinical findings between juvenile and adult-onset Behçet’s disease.
*From: Yildiz M, Koker O, Kasapcopur O. Juvenile Behçet syndrome: a contemporary view and differential diagnosis in pediatric practice. Curr Opin Rheumatol. 2025;37(1):3-14.
